Church,Rock,Sedona,Arizon,Red Rock,HDR,Black & White, Silver EfexMelissa and I were on vacation in Arizona visiting her friend Katie. We took a drive from Tempe to Sedona in order to experience the famous red rocks. During the road trip we head about the Church in the rock. When we pulled up to the incredible sight I knew I had to spend some time capturing the church in all of its glory. The color version of this photo was published in Issue 19(11/2008) of JPG Magazine on pages 40 & 41.
